What are the Turmeric Pills?
Turmeric pills are one of the products made from turmeric that are available commercially .As in many areas the Turmeric is not available and making it in powder form takes time, pills are available in the market to be ingested as per the instructions of doctor. These pills are prepared taking the correct composition of Turmeric, Corcumin and Bioperine.
To be genuinely compelling a Turmeric Pill needs to incorporate BioPerine which improves the assimilation of the curcumin. Turmeric Curcumin is not dissolvable in water so without BioPerine the Turmeric Concentrate will have insignificant advantage.

The root is collected, cleaned, dried, and powdered to be utilized as a zest (turmeric gives curry its delightful brilliant yellow shading) and as a drug. Customarily, turmeric was utilized for almost every wellbeing condition known - from smallpox to a sprained lower leg. The explanation behind its wellbeing impacts is the compound known as curcumin. Similarly as oranges are a wellspring of vitamin C, turmeric is a wellspring of curcumin. Today, we remove curcumin from turmeric to use as a characteristic medication.
An average turmeric root contains around 2-5% curcumin, so taking an unstandardized, powdered turmeric root item implies that substantial sums would be required to get an advantageous measure of curcumin. Furthermore, curcumin is inadequately ingested from the gastrointestinal tract. While turmeric is phenomenal when utilized as a flavor, a curcumin separate is a superior decision for medical advantages.

Diabetes: People with diabetes should use caution in taking these pills. Curcumin- chemical in turmeric can decrease the blood sugar too low.
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D): Turmeric can upset the stomach in some people. Use caution if you see any symptom of worse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D).
Iron Deficiency: Consuming high amount of turmeric can prevent the absorption of iron in body. People with deficiency of iron should avoid taking it
Surgery: High use of turmeric can slow down the blood clotting process. People recently undergone surgery should avoid using it in excess.
